Novartis drug investigated after 11 deaths

AppId is over the quota
AppId is over the quota
LONDON (AP) — A European agency is investigating a multiple sclerosis drug made by industry giant Novartis to determine whether the medicine played any role in the deaths at least 11 patients.

The drug, Gilenya, was licensed last year in the European Union to treat a severe type of multiple sclerosis. It can cause a slow heart rate when first taken and doctors closely monitor patients after the first dose.

The European Medicines Agency, which is now investigating the drug, said it isn't clear if it caused the deaths. One of the fatalities occurred in the United States, where a patient died within 24 hours of taking the first dose.

The European agency said it didn't know where the other 10 deaths occurred, but that they were reported to its drug database, which monitors side effects from medicines in the European Union.

Novartis said not all the deaths were heart related.

A spokeswoman at the U.S. Food and Drug Administration said it also is conducting a data analysis but has not made any definitive conclusions and does not know when its review will be complete.

More than 30,000 patients have taken Gilenya worldwide.

The European Medicines Agency advised doctors to increase their monitoring of patients after the first dose of the medicine. The agency said the risk of a slow heart rate after the first dose of Gilenya was known when it was approved.

Novartis AG said it was advising doctors of new recommendations on using Gilenya. They had previously said all patients should be monitored for six hours after their first dose, but are now tightening that to include continuous heart monitoring using electrocardiograms and measuring blood pressure and heart rate every hour. In certain patients, that monitoring should be extended, the drug maker said in a statement.

This new guidance applies only to patients taking their first dose, Novartis said in a statement.

The EU drug regulator hopes to finish its review of the drug by March.

After dieting, hormone changes may fuel weight regain

AppId is over the quota
AppId is over the quota

(Health.com) -- Losing weight is hard, but keeping the pounds off can be even harder.

By some estimates, as many as 80% of overweight people who manage to slim down noticeably after a diet gain some or all of the weight back within one year.

A shortage of willpower may not be the only reason for this rebound weight gain. According to a new study in the New England Journal of Medicine, hunger-related hormones disrupted by dieting and weight loss can remain at altered levels for at least a year, fueling a heartier-than-normal appetite and thwarting the best intentions of dieters.

"Maintaining weight loss may be more difficult than losing weight," says lead researcher Joseph Proietto, Ph.D., a professor of medicine at the University of Melbourne's Heidelberg Repatriation Hospital, in Victoria, Australia. "This may be due to biological changes rather than [a] voluntary return to old habits."

Scientists have known for years that hormones found in the gut, pancreas, and fatty tissue strongly influence body weight and processes such as hunger and calorie burning. And the reverse is also true: A drop in body fat percentage, for instance, causes a decrease in the levels of certain hormones (such as leptin, which signals to your brain when you're full) and an increase in others (such as ghrelin, which stimulates hunger).

What wasn't so well known, until now, was whether these changes in hormone levels persist after an individual loses weight. To find out, Proietto and his colleagues put 50 overweight or obese men and women on a very low-calorie diet for 10 weeks, then tracked their hormone levels for one year.

The average weight loss during the initial diet period was about 30 pounds, which for most of the participants represented at least 10% of their starting body weight. (Seven people who did not meet this target were dismissed from the study.) Blood tests showed that average levels of several hormones (including leptin, ghrelin, and insulin) had changed as a result of the weight loss. As expected, the participants also reported being hungrier -- both before and after breakfast -- than they had been at the study's start.

At the 10-week mark the participants were allowed to resume a normal diet, but they continued to receive periodic advice from a dietitian and were also encouraged to get 30 minutes of exercise most days of the week. One year later, they'd regained about 12 pounds, on average, and follow-up tests showed that their hormone levels had only partially stabilized. Their hunger levels remained elevated as well.

The results aren't surprising, says Charles Burant, M.D., the director of the University of Michigan Nutrition Obesity Research Center, in Ann Arbor, who was not involved in the research. In fact, he says, the hormone changes seen in the study are a well-known evolutionary survival tactic.

"Multiple mechanisms have been developed, over eons of evolution, to get you to regain weight once you lose it...to tell your brain you're hungry and to ensure that you don't stop eating," he says. "If you don't have those drives, you wouldn't be alive."

But now that we live in a world where calories are so easily consumed and physical exercise -- the best way to burn off those calories -- is largely unnecessary for day-to-day survival, these biological drives are backfiring and contributing to obesity, Burant says.

That's not to say that weight regain is inevitable, or that these drives can't be overcome through willpower. Although the hormone changes noted in the study are very real physical effects, Proietto says, personality and psychological factors may play a role in an individual's ability to manage chronic hunger.

"This may explain why some people maintain weight loss for longer than others," he says. "Maintenance of weight loss requires continued vigilance and conscious effort to resist hunger."

Promising research is being done to discover ways to restore hormone levels in people who lose weight, Burant says. Preliminary studies from Columbia University, for example, have found that when dieters are injected with replacement leptin hormones, it's easier for them to maintain or continue weight loss.

"When diabetics don't have enough insulin in their bodies, we give them back insulin in order to maintain their blood glucose," Burant says. Researchers should be finding a way to do the same for people who have lost weight, he adds, "whether it's with a drug, a dietary supplement, or certain nutrients—something that will stimulate the release of these hormones."

Proietto agrees that finding an appetite suppressant of this sort is the next logical step in hormone and obesity research. Until then, he says, weight-loss surgery is a possible option for some severely obese people who have not been able to keep weight off by other methods.

Daughter to get $10 M for amputations after ER

SACRAMENTO, California (AP) - the family of a California toddler whose foot, the left hand and part of his right hand was amputated due to delay of the long emergency room has agreed to a settlement of $ 10 million malpractice.

Malyia Jeffers was 2 years old when her parents took her to the Methodist Hospital of Sacramento in November last with fever, skin colour, and weakness. According to court documents, the family said to wait.

"While in the waiting room, Malyia grows more ill and weak," according to the complaint filed in superior court in Sacramento, February 14. "The parents of several times asked Malyia and pray (workers of the hospital) treat their daughter.".

Rather, the hospital said to continue waiting and it was five hours before Malyia was first seen by a physician, said the document.

"Ryan Jeffers and Leah Yang saw their daughter get weaker and sicker as (workers of the hospital) hours chose to delay the treatment," said the complaint. "They have seen the bruises on his body increase, affecting her legs, the arms and face." "They were afraid that she would die in the waiting room".

Malyia was stolen from the Lucile Packard Children's Stanford University Hospital. Doctors concluded that the Streptococcus bacteria has invaded his blood and organs, and they performed amputations.

Court documents show that most of the money will be placed in a trust for the current needs of the Malyia and an annuity which will provide him $16 932 per month, when she turns 18. The monthly payment develops over time, so the time that malyia is 30, the monthly payment is almost double.

The settlement with the Hospital of Sacramento and its parent company, Catholic Healthcare West, ranks among the most important in the history of California, under the medical malpractice attorneys.

The family has signed a non-disclosure agreement and could not discuss the case, their attorney Moseley Collins said Friday.

"What we can say, is that Malyia has a new set of artificial legs and she is walking on those", said Collins. "We are pleased that we managed to resolve the case."

Malyia spent more than three months at Stanford, before being admitted to another hospital in Sacramento. It is still being processed and will need expensive medicines and custom prostheses, special clothing and wheelchairs for the rest of his life.

Alcohol linked to better survival after heart attack

n">(Reuters) - Women who drank anywhere from a few alcoholic drinks a month to more than three a week in the year leading up to a heart attack ended up living longer than women who never drank alcohol, according to a U.S. study.

The findings, which focused on more than 1,000 women and were published in the American Journal of Cardiology, add to mounting evidence that alcohol, regardless of the type of drink, can be good for the heart.

"One thing that was interesting was that we didn't see differences among different beverage types," said Joshua Rosenbloom, a student at Harvard Medical School who led the study.

"The most recent evidence suggests that it's the alcohol itself that's beneficial."

There was a similarly reduced risk of dying within the follow up period whether the women drank wine, beer or hard liquor, Rosenbloom and his colleagues found.

"One drink a day is a really good target, assuming that a person can be disciplined about that," said James O'Keefe, a cardiologist at St. Luke's Health System in Kansas City, Missouri, who was not involved in the study.

Researchers surveyed more than 1,200 women hospitalized for a heart attack. They asked questions about how many alcoholic drinks the women usually consumed, along with other health and lifestyle questions.

After at least 10 years of follow up, the team found that 44 out of every 100 women who had abstained from alcohol had died, while 25 out of every 100 light drinkers and 18 out of every 100 heavy drinkers had died.

This translated to about a 35 percent lower chance of dying during the follow up period for women who drank, compared to those who didn't.

In an earlier study including men and women, O'Keefe found that people who continued to drink moderately after having a heart attack had better health than those who abstained.

"You don't need to assume that people need to stop drinking once they develop heart disease," he said.

"The problem is that alcohol is a slippery slope, and while we know that a little bit is good for us, a lot of it is really bad." SOURCE: bit.ly/uU3Eor

After knee repair, half can't play sports the same

n">(Reuters) - After knee reconstruction surgery, half of people who played sports both competitively and just for fun don't perform as well as they used to, according to an Australian study.

Of more than 300 men and women who had the surgery, a third stopped playing sports entirely and 68 who were still active said they didn't play as well as before, researchers reported in the American Journal of Sports Medicine.

The anterior cruciate ligament, or ACL, is the ligament inside the knee that helps keep the joint stable. About 150,000 ACL injuries occur each year in the United States.

"Less than 50 percent of the study sample had returned to playing sport at their preinjury level or returned to participating in competitive sport when surveyed at 2 to 7 years after ACL reconstruction surgery," wrote Clare Ardern at La Trobe University in Victoria, Australia, who led the study.

Ardern and her colleagues followed more than 300 men and women for two to seven years. Participants had either played Australian-rules football, basketball, netball or soccer before their surgeries.

At 39 months post-surgery, 208 out of the 314 people who had the operation were still playing a sport, the researchers said.

Of those 208, 68 said they played at a lower level than before their injury and 140 said they played about the same as before their injury. The remaining 106 participants either were not playing sports or did not complete the entire study.

"Although almost all people returned to playing some form of sport, they did not play continuously for many years after their surgery," Ardern told Reuters Health in an email.

She also noted there may be other reasons why people stopped playing sports, such as fear of getting injured again or less confidence in performing.

Of the 196 people who played competitive sports before their injury, 91 returned to their competitive sport.

"This is a big injury," said Edward McDevitt, a spokesman for the American Academy of Orthopaedic Surgeons, who was not part of the study.

"Many athletes who choose surgery have a long and difficult road to face. If you're not willing to go through it, then you might be better off just getting a brace."

He added that while knee surgery does allow people to return to their sport, they couldn't perform as well as doctors might wish.

People who tear the ACL can either opt for physical therapy and surgery or just physical therapy alone.

"Some people find that they are able to function well without surgery, provided they have adequate leg strength to support the injured knee," Ardern said.

"Other alternatives may be to avoid sports involving direction changes, jumping and landing or activities that make the knee feel unstable, or use knee braces and supports."

McDevitt speculates that after surgery, some athletes may not have the same range of motion, preventing them from playing as before.

"I tell my patients, 'I can't make you like before, I'm not God. But I'll do the best I can to restore you back to the way you were,'" he added. SOURCE: bit.ly/pWId18

Woman gives birth after marathon

Instead of having a rest after completing the Chicago Marathon, pregnant Amber Miller gave birth.

Mrs Miller, who was nearly 39 weeks pregnant, said "it was the longest day of my life". She gave birth to a healthy 7.7lb (3.5kg) girl, June.

The marathon was the eighth for the 27-year-old, who already had one child. On her doctor's orders she ran half and walked half the distance.

"Lots of people were cheering me on: 'Go pregnant lady'," she said.

"For me, it wasn't anything out of the ordinary. I was running up until that point anyway," she told Associated Press news agency.

"I am crazy about running."

Because she half-walked the race, she finished the 26.2 mile (42.16km) course in 6:25 - slower than her usual pace.

"A few minutes after finishing, the contractions became stronger than normal and I understood what was going on," she said.

"When they became more regular, we had a sandwich and then we left for hospital," Mrs Miller added.

Greece health warning after cuts

Researchers have issued a warning about the health of people in Greece in the wake of the financial crisis.

Writing in The Lancet, they said cuts to hospitals' budgets meant they were being overstretched.

More people were reporting "bad health" and HIV infections were on the increase, the authors warned.

While public health experts said the picture was "concerning" they said it could take several years for the true health implications to fully emerge.

Greece has been at the centre of the economic turmoil in Europe and researchers say the austerity measures have taken a toll on health services.

"There were about 40% cuts in hospital budgets, understaffing, reported occasional shortage of medical supplies, and bribes given to medical staff to jump queues in overstretched hospitals," they wrote.

At the same time there was a 24% increase in public hospital admissions, partly fuelled by fewer patients using private hospitals.

An analysis of data from EU Statistics on Income and Living Conditions, comparing 2007 and 2009, showed a 15% increase in people not going to a doctor or dentist, mostly due "to long waiting times".

The researchers said: "We noted a significant rise [14%] in the prevalence of people reporting that their health was bad or very bad."

They also reported a decline in the number of people eligible for sickness benefit.

New infections of HIV were expected to increase by 52% in 2011, with half due to intravenous drug use.

Their report concludes: "Ordinary people are paying the ultimate price: losing access to care and preventative services.

"Greater attention to health and healthcare access is needed."

However, there is no data on the actual health of Greek citizens.

Dr Alexander Kentikelenis, of the University of Cambridge, told the BBC: "Many implications will take longer to show. In the Great Depression it took five-plus years for the effects to show in health in the US."

Scientist wins Nobel 3 days after cancer death

(AP Photo/Seth Wenig)eval("var currentItemd57851005a80479aaeeb90a12c70b9ff = 1;");eval("var nextd57851005a80479aaeeb90a12c70b9ff = 0;");eval("var previousd57851005a80479aaeeb90a12c70b9ff = 0;"); NEW YORK (AP) — Ralph Steinman, a pioneer in understanding how cells fight disease, tried to help his own immune system thwart his pancreatic cancer.

Steinman survived until Friday. Three days later, he was awarded the Nobel Prize for medicine.

The Nobel committee, unaware of his death, announced the award Monday in Stockholm. Steinman's employer, Rockefeller University in New York, learned of his death after the Nobel announcement.

Steinman's wife, Claudia, said the family had planned to disclose his death Monday — only to discover an email to his cellphone from the Nobel committee.

Friends and colleagues were stunned by his death.

"For the last five years, I've gotten up in the morning of the Nobel Prize announcement and rushed to the computer to see his name," said Olivera J. Finn of the University of Pittsburgh.

"And this morning I saw it, and I just totally shrieked with joy," she said. Then she heard the bad news from a friend in Singapore.

"I have been this whole morning ... out of breath like somebody punched me in the stomach," Finn said.

Experts disagree whether Steinman's research helped him live for 4½ years after he was diagnosed. A colleague in his lab thinks it did. The odds of making it even a year with his type of cancer are less than 5 percent.

Nobel officials said they believed it was the first time that a laureate had died before the announcement without the committee's knowledge.

"It is incredibly sad news," said Nobel Foundation chairman Lars Heikensten. "We can only regret that he didn't have the chance to receive the news he had won the Nobel Prize. Our thoughts are now with his family."

Since 1974, the Nobel statutes don't allow posthumous awards unless a laureate dies after the announcement but before the Dec. 10 award ceremony. That happened in 1996 when economics winner William Vickrey died a few days after the announcement.

However, the committee said Monday that Steinman's award would stand and that his survivors would receive his share of the $1.5 million prize.

The Canadian-born Steinman, 68, was awarded the prize along with American Bruce Beutler and French scientist Jules Hoffmann. They were honored for discoveries about the body's disease-fighting immune system.

Steinman discovered so-called dendritic cells in 1973. These cells regulate the activity of other cells — Steinman called them the conductor of the immune system.

"When he got sick, he realized he needed to call upon these cells to induce a strong enough immune response to fight his tumor, and that is what he did," said Dr. Sarah Schlesinger, clinical director for his lab.

Steinman tried eight to 10 experimental therapies approved by the federal government, focusing in various ways on revving up his immune system to fight his cancer, she said.

Colleagues came forward with their best approaches for other kinds of cancer, and Steinman analyzed what seemed the most promising for him.

In one approach, for example, samples of Steinman's own dendritic cells were loaded with protein markers from his tumor, and then reinjected into his body. The idea was that this would "teach his immune system how to respond to that tumor," said Rockefeller colleague Dr. Michel Nussenzweig.

Although he also underwent chemotherapy, "he didn't really want to take it because he wanted to be cured," Nussenzweig said. "And he felt the immune system would be the best way to effect a cure, as opposed to just living with the disease."

Dozens of scientists around the world pitched in on the effort, Nussenzweig said. "Ralph was a special person, and they were all eager to do anything to try to cure him."

The experimental therapy continued until just recently, he said, but "there's no way of knowing whether it worked or not."

Steinman was the only patient, with no control group — other patients with the same cancer for comparison, a scientific must for convincing evidence. "It's not the kind of experiment Ralph would have liked to have done."

Rockefeller University said "his life was extended" using the therapy of his own design. Schlesinger believes that, pointing to the poor survival odds for his tumor and his good quality of life during his treatment. Noting that he also got chemotherapy, she said, "I think it all worked together."

But Dr. Alan Venook, a pancreatic cancer specialist at the University of California, San Francisco, cautioned against drawing conclusions about the impact of the treatments.

He said surviving four years with pancreatic cancer "is a long time," but not out of the question, depending on the type and how advanced it was when it was found.

"It's a disservice to the field for anyone to say that his immune therapy prolonged his life," Venook added.

"The phones will be ringing off the hook" with desperate patients who mistakenly believe that these experimental treatments have been proved safe or effective when in fact they have not, he said.

Finn said Steinman used several experimental therapies based on the immune system "because he believed in that as a solution to the problem of cancer." She said she believed the approach prolonged his life.

Nussenzweig said Steinman was working on his laboratory research until just a week ago.

He was open and honest about his cancer and "talked about it with a lot of people," Nussenzweig said.

"He was incredibly heroic in how he handled his disease," Finn said. "It was something important to fight. He continued his science, his publications, his experiments. He appeared at all the meetings. He received multiple prizes. He traveled.

"He wasn't delusional in any way, but he was not going to let the disease change his life. Science was his life, and he stayed with it until the end."

Hoffmann, 70, headed a research laboratory in Strasbourg, France, between 1974 and 2009 and served as president of the French National Academy of Sciences in 2007-08.

Beutler, 53, holds dual appointments at the University of Texas Southwestern Medical Center in Dallas and as professor of genetics and immunology at the Scripps Research Institute in San Diego. He will become a full-time faculty member at UT Southwestern on Dec. 1.

Beutler and Hoffmann were cited for their discoveries in the 1990s of receptor proteins that can recognize bacteria and other microorganisms as they enter the body, and activate the first line of defense in the immune system, known as innate immunity.

The work of the three men has enabled the development of improved vaccines against infectious diseases, and in the long term could yield better treatments of cancer, rheumatoid arthritis, Type 1 diabetes, multiple sclerosis, and chronic inflammatory diseases, Nobel committee members said.

The work could also help efforts to make the immune system fight cancer, the committee said. A new treatment, Provenge, uses this concept to attack advanced prostate cancer.

"I am very touched," Hoffmann said. "I'm thinking of all the people who worked with me, who gave everything. I wasn't sure this domain merited a Nobel."

Beutler said he woke up in the middle of the night, glanced at his cellphone and realized he had a new email message.

"And, I squinted at it and I saw that the title line was 'Nobel Prize,' so I thought I should give close attention to that," Beutler said in an interview posted on the Nobel website.

When he opened it, he saw that it was from Nobel committee member Goran Hansson, "and it said that I had won the Nobel Prize, and so I was thrilled."

The medicine award kicked off a week of prize announcements, with the physics prize on Tuesday, chemistry on Wednesday, literature on Thursday and the Nobel Peace Prize on Friday. The winners of the economics award will be announced Oct. 10.

The coveted prizes were established by wealthy Swedish industrialist Alfred Nobel — the inventor of dynamite — except for the economics award, which was created by Sweden's central bank in 1968 in Nobel's memory. The prizes are always handed out on Dec. 10, the anniversary of Nobel's death in 1896.

Decade after anthrax attacks, worry over stockpile

WASHINGTON (AP) — Anthrax vaccine — check. Antibiotics — check. A botulism treatment — check. Smallpox vaccine — check.

Ten years after the anthrax attacks brought home the reality of bioterrorism, the nation has a stockpile of some basic tools to fight back against a few of the threats that worry defense experts the most.

These defenses are not just gathering dust awaiting the next attack. In August, a Minneapolis hospital dipped into the stockpile to treat a critically ill patient — a tourist who, somewhere on his Midwest vacation, had the extraordinary bad luck to breathe anthrax spores that naturally linger in the dirt in parts of the country. The man, who survived, received a kind of medication not available in October 2001 when anthrax spores sent through the mail killed five people and sickened 17.

But there's wide concern that the nation's arsenal hasn't grown fast enough. A decade later, there are no treatments for a number of bugs on the worry list, and little to offer for other threats like a radiation emergency. Even a long-promised next-generation anthrax vaccine, that would be easier to produce, hasn't arrived yet. Nor is there information on how to treat children.

"Where are the countermeasures?" advisers to the Department of Health and Human Services asked in a critical report last year.

There are some: There's enough smallpox vaccine for everyone, plus some of a specially formulated version safe for cancer patients and others with weak immune systems. There's an improved version of the decades-old anthrax vaccine used in 2001. There are a few treatments for the toxins produced by anthrax and botulism, and a smallpox treatment is due soon.

But federal health officials are working to jumpstart production of more countermeasures and they say that more than 80 candidates are in advanced development. Over the past year, the goal has evolved into a push for more multiuse therapies, products that work not just for biodefense but for everyday health problems, too.

That's a major shift that should entice more big drug companies to the field, says Dr. Robin Robinson, who heads the federal Biomedical Advanced Research and Development Authority, or BARDA. It funds late-stage research of promising countermeasures.

Consider: BARDA just agreed to help pay for drug giant GlaxoSmithKline's testing of a novel antibiotic that might fight bioterrorism germs like plague — as well as certain hospital-spread bacteria that cause such problems as pneumonia in the already seriously ill.

So-called broad-spectrum antibiotics that can kill more than one kind of bacteria aren't unusual — this one just targets some hard-to-treat types in a new way.

The next step: Scientists are beginning to create the first broad-spectrum antivirals, medicines that would treat more than one kind of virus. Rather than having an anti-flu drug and a separate anti-AIDS drug, the goal is to have a single injection that could treat those viruses plus the gruesome Ebola virus and a few more for good measure.

It's early work, still years away, cautions Dr. Michael Kurilla, biodefense research chief at the National Institute of Allergy and Infectious Diseases. But one of the antivirals is a direct result of biodefense research to understand how viruses infect — specifically, the Nipah virus that was the model for the even-scarier fictional bug in the new movie "Contagion."

And these multipurpose antivirals are a huge goal because if they pan out, the next time a brand-new virus emerges — like the respiratory SARS bug in 2003 — treatments might not have to be started from scratch.

"We feel very excited and confident that what we're working on ... can change the whole paradigm of how we approach infectious diseases," Kurilla says.

The U.S. has invested $67 billion in biosecurity since 2001, according to research by the Center for Biosecurity at the University of Pittsburgh Medical Center.

Most of that wasn't solely for biodefense but went to broader health programs that are as crucial for dealing with natural crises — like the 2009 swine flu global epidemic — as for dealing with manmade ones, says center director Dr. Thomas Inglesby. These include scientific research, beefing up struggling public health departments to better detect and treat emerging outbreaks, and training hospitals in disaster preparedness.

Inglesby worries that the economic crisis imperils those gains — public health funding already has been cut — and will further slow the countermeasure hunt. A program named BioShield that buys countermeasures for the stockpile expires in 2013 unless Congress reauthorizes it. It's time, he says, for the government to spell out its countermeasure priorities and how to reach them.

Meanwhile, what if another anthrax attack happened? No more scrambling to buy antibiotics: 60 million 60-day treatment courses are stockpiled, Robinson says, and the plan is for the U.S. Postal Service to deliver some of those first doses to people's homes.

Sometimes antibiotics aren't enough. In a severe infection, the germs can produce dangerous toxins that spread in the bloodstream. So also in the stockpile are two experimental toxin-clearing treatments, to be used if the immune system alone can't battle the toxin.

In August, Minnesota's sick tourist became the 19th person in the world ever treated with one of them — immune globulin culled from the blood of anthrax-vaccinated soldiers, says Dr. Mark Sprenkle of Hennepin County Medical Center. It's hard to know how much the drug contributed to the man's recovery, Sprenkle says, but his patient's toxin levels did drop more quickly after he began using it.

Too Good To Be True? Anti-Aging Proteins Not So Potent After All

AppId is over the quota
AppId is over the quota

New research suggests that the promising longevity gene may not lead to longer lives after all.

In recent years, studies have led some scientists to believe that the genes that make sirtuins, proteins that affect cell metabolism, could yield new targets for drugs that would extend life.

Early work in worms and fruit flies suggested that boosting sirtuins could extend life by up to 50%. Other experiments in lab animals also suggested that the proteins were responsible for the life-extending effects of calorie restriction. And even more encouraging for people, it turned out that resveratrol, a compound found in red wine, could activate the proteins.

The results were robust enough to convince some of the proteins' earliest advocates, researchers from Harvard and Massachusetts of Institute of Technology, to found a company, Sirtis, to begin testing sirtuin-boosting agents.

But in a new report in Nature, scientists at the Institute of Health Ageing at the University College London say the foundational work connecting sirtuins to longer life in animals was flawed. The main problem, the authors write, is that the experiments didn't take into account the effects of other genes that might have in influencing longevity. And some of these effects, they say, might differ between lab-bred animals and their naturally occurring, or 'wild' counterparts.

When the authors of the Nature paper, led by David Gems, reproduced the early studies in worms and flies and accounted for other genetic factors that could impact longevity, the effect of sirtuins disappeared.

The researchers also tested whether fruit fly sirtuin could be activated by resveratrol — with no luck. And they concluded that the life-extending effect of calorie restriction was not in fact due to sirtuins.

"Studies on yeast lifespan were the first to cast doubt on the role of sirtuins in longevity," noted the authors of an accompanying commentary in Nature, reported the AFP. The new study "puts a final nail in the coffin."

In a second paper published Nature, however, one of the discoverers of sirtuins attests that the proteins do extend life in worms, just not as much as previously thought. Reuters reported:

Leonard Guarente, a professor at the Massachusetts Institute of Technology and co-chair of the Scientific Advisory Board of Sirtris Pharmaceuticals, owned by GlaxoSmithKline, wrote that the first research on sirtuins "overestimated the extension of lifespan" in a worm with high levels of the proteins. Now, his team calculates, making a lot of sirtuins seems to increase a worm's lifespan by about 10 to 14 percent, all else being equal.

Guarente's group argues that sirtuins may still play an important protective role in mammals, shielding cells from the metabolic damage of daily living and safeguarding against age-related disease. He told Reuters: "I feel that the sirtuins are really the most important and actionable thing to come out of aging research, and I'm very hopeful that we will have drugs in the future based on this work to treat the major diseases of aging."

Gems also acknowledges that the proteins may prove useful in human health in some way — potentially aiding in the development of treatments for metabolic diseases like diabetes — but that their importance in extending life may not be as strong as scientists had claimed. Researchers "got carried away" with their excitement on that front, he told Reuters.

FDA: Ozone-Unfriendly Asthma Inhalers Won't Be Available After 2011

Asthma patients who rely on over-the-counter inhalers will need to switch to prescription-only alternatives as part of the federal government's latest attempt to protect the Earth's atmosphere.

The Food and Drug Administration said Thursday patients who use the epinephrine inhalers to treat mild asthma will need to switch by Dec. 31 to other types that do not contain chlorofluorocarbons, an aerosol substance once found in a variety of spray products.

The action is part of an agreement signed by the U.S. and other nations to stop using substances that deplete the ozone layer, a region in the atmosphere that helps block harmful ultraviolet rays from the Sun.

But the switch to a greener inhaler will cost consumers more. Epinephrine inhalers are available via online retailers for around $20, whereas the alternatives, which contain the drug albuterol, range from $30 to $60.

The FDA finalized plans to phase out the products in 2008 and currently only Armstrong Pharmaceutical's Primatene mist is available in the U.S. Other manufacturers have switched to an environmentally-friendly propellant called hydrofluoroalkane. Both types of inhalers offer quick-relief to symptoms like shortness of breath and chest tightness, but the environmentally-friendly inhalers are only available via prescription.

"If you rely on an over-the-counter inhaler to relieve your asthma symptoms, it is important that you contact a health care professional to talk about switching to a different medicine to treat your asthma," said Badrul Chowdhury, FDA's director of pulmonary drug division.

Chowdhury told reporters and doctors via teleconference that "in the worst case scenario we are looking at 1 to 2 million people using" Primatene, adding that most of those patients likely use multiple medications to treat their asthma.

Nyad resumes swim after jellyfish stings

(CNN) -- Undeterred by stings, endurance swimmer Diana Nyad returned to the water early Sunday morning in her attempt to swim from Cuba to Florida.

She was accompanied by three shark divers, her team said in a blog post.

The 62-year-old was pulled out Saturday night after she was stung for a second time, this time by some kind of presumed jellyfish, her team said.

Later that night, an independent observer from the International Swim Federation said Nyad could still be in the running for a record.

"Diana may continue the swim if she has only been removed from the water for medical treatment. In other words, not simply to rest," her team said in a post. "Diana's swim will still be record breaking if she decides to continue."

Now that Nyad has decided to go on, her attempt will be considered a "staged swim," meaning that it occurred in stages rather than nonstop.

Nyad's first Cuba-Florida attempt, back in 1978, was brought to an end by strong currents and bad weather after almost 42 hours in the water.

She made a try in August, before she was pulled from the water after 60 miles, and almost 29 hours of swimming. She blamed a shoulder injury she suffered early in the journey, and an 11-hour-long asthma attack.

Her latest attempt began just after 6 p.m. Friday from Havana's Hemingway Marina. The former world champion swimmer expects the swim to take close to 60 hours.

There was a bit of excitement early Saturday afternoon. An oceanic whitetip shark swam near Nyad, but a diver on her team faced it off and it meandered away.

The swimmer improved her performance late Saturday morning after struggling to maintain her usual stroke rate, her support team said. Fortified by chicken soup, Nyad was making good progress until the Saturday evening incident.

The sting was the second of the day. Earlier in the day, a Portuguese man o' war stung her.

Nyad got back in the water at 12:20 a.m. Sunday.
